Stellar’s Q4 Report is Bullish—Can XLM Go Up 120%?
Stellar’s (XLM) Q4 2024 report has investors excited about network growth and RWA sector expansion. Despite market-wide headwinds, XLM is holding above $0.34 support. Earlier in January, XLM went up 45% and almost touched $0.50.
In Q4, Stellar price went from $0.075 to $0.63; that’s 280% up for the year. Though it has retraced, it’s still positioned for upside.
Stellar’s latest quarterly report shows key growth metrics:
-
9 million active addresses.
-
$4.1 billion in total transaction volume.
-
$458 million in tokenized assets, 4th in the RWA sector.
Stellar is one of the most cost-efficient blockchains with transaction fees of $0.000010. It’s a great choice for enterprises and payment providers looking for scalable solutions. Plus, the recent SLP-0001 upgrade allows it to support complex DApps, further strengthening its fundamentals.
